The Enchanted Labyrinth of Echoing Whispers

Once upon a time, in the quaint village of Willowbrook, there lived a group of friends who were inseparable. They were known as the Dreamcatchers, a trio of kindred spirits who possessed the rare ability to weave dreams and reality together. Their leader, Elara, was the most skilled Dreamcatcher, her dreams painting vivid landscapes and telling tales of wonder.

One fateful day, as the sun dipped below the horizon, casting a golden hue over the village, Elara received a vision. In her dream, she saw her dear friend, Lila, trapped within a labyrinth of shadows, her eyes wide with fear and confusion. The labyrinth was a place of endless wandering, where the paths twisted and turned like the threads of a dreamcatcher's web, and the walls whispered secrets long forgotten.

Elara awoke from her vision, her heart pounding with concern. She knew she had to act, for Lila's spirit was entangled in the labyrinth, her dreams becoming a haunting echo of the world she once knew. The Dreamcatchers gathered, and Elara shared her vision, her voice tinged with urgency.

"I must go into the labyrinth," Elara declared, her eyes filled with resolve. "I must find Lila and break the spell that binds her to this eternal night."

Her friends, understanding the gravity of the situation, nodded in agreement. "We will go with you," said Finn, the brave and resourceful Dreamcatcher with a knack for finding hidden paths. "Together, we can face any challenge."

And so, with the moon as their guide, the Dreamcatchers set out for the labyrinth. The path to the labyrinth was treacherous, filled with illusions that tried to deter them. One moment, they would see a clear path before them, only to find themselves face-to-face with a roaring fire, its flames dancing in the wind as if mocking their resolve.

"Be careful," Finn warned, his voice barely above a whisper. "The labyrinth is a master of deception."

As they ventured deeper, the whispers grew louder, each one a memory of Lila's past, a whisper of joy, sorrow, and longing. The Dreamcatchers listened, their hearts aching for their friend.

"We must find the heart of the labyrinth," Elara said, her voice steady despite the fear that gripped her. "That is where Lila is trapped."

The labyrinth seemed to have a mind of its own, shifting and changing as they moved. They encountered creatures of Lila's dreams, both friendly and fierce, each one testing their resolve. They fought, they laughed, and they cried, their bond growing stronger with each challenge.

Finally, they reached the heart of the labyrinth, a vast chamber where the walls seemed to close in on them. In the center stood a pedestal, and upon it lay Lila, her eyes closed, her spirit bound by the labyrinth's magic.

Elara approached the pedestal, her heart pounding. "Lila, we're here," she whispered, her voice breaking.

Lila's eyes fluttered open, and she looked at Elara, her face filled with relief. "Elara... how did you find me?"

"We knew you were here," Elara replied, her voice filled with determination. "And we would not rest until we found you."

With the help of their friends, Elara began to unravel the labyrinth's magic. They used the power of their dreams, weaving reality with the dreamscape, until the walls began to crumble, and the shadows retreated.

Lila gasped as the light returned to her eyes, her spirit freed from the labyrinth's grasp. "Thank you," she said, her voice trembling with emotion.

The Dreamcatchers gathered around her, their faces beaming with relief and joy. "We did it," Finn said, his voice filled with pride.

As the labyrinth's magic faded, the village of Willowbrook returned to its tranquil state. The Dreamcatchers returned to their lives, their bond stronger than ever, knowing that they had saved their friend from the depths of the labyrinthine dream.

And so, the tale of the Enchanted Labyrinth of Echoing Whispers was told, a story of friendship, courage, and the indomitable spirit of those who believe in the power of dreams.
